Job Description

Primary Function: Safely transport youth ages 6–18 and staff between Club locations, schools, and approved program sites in accordance with BGCD’s mission and safety standards. Ensure a positive, respectful environment on the vehicle; complete required documentation; and support Club operations between routes. Vehicle Transportation/Maintenance
  • Complete and document pre- and post-trip vehicle inspections; promptly report safety/mechanical issues.
  • Follow assigned routes and schedules; communicate delays, hazards, or route changes to supervisors.
  • Safely pick up and drop off members and staff at designated locations; verify authorized riders.
  • Enforce safety procedures (e.g., seat belts, appropriate behavior) and BGCD policies on the vehicle.
  • Maintain accurate rosters, attendance logs, incident reports, mileage/fuel logs, and cleanliness of vehicles.
  • Coordinate routine maintenance, fueling, and repairs with supervisor and vendors as directed.
  • Operate vehicles in compliance with Ohio traffic laws and BGCD policies, modeling defensive driving.
  • Professionally communicate with caregivers, school personnel, and staff; escalate concerns appropriately.
